  • What is your aftercare? If you're using something you're spreading over your skin, you may be having a reaction to that. Is your piercing itself swollen or painful? Is it still bleeding, or is there pus, or is the area warm? And what material was it pierced with? First thing you should wash the area gently and then see your piercer about it. Honestly it sounds like a rash from something you're using, but it's also possible you are allergic to the jewelry material or that it's something else altogether.
